Series 1 (CMRC) reported Q1 2026 earnings per share of $0.13, beating the consensus estimate of $0.1047 by approximately 24.16%. Revenue figures were not disclosed for the quarter. Despite the strong earnings beat, the stock declined by 2.03%, indicating potential investor concerns regarding transparency or forward outlook.

Management highlighted robust operational execution and disciplined cost controls as key drivers of the EPS beat. The company achieved a notable expansion in profit margins, though specific revenue data was not provided. Segment performance appeared mixed, with the core commerce platform showing solid engagement trends and improving customer retention metrics. Management emphasized ongoing investments in automation and AI-driven tools to enhance efficiency and reduce operating costs. The quarter demonstrated the company's ability to surpass profit expectations through tight expense management and strategic resource allocation. However, the lack of revenue disclosure may have left some analysts questioning the sustainability of earnings growth, particularly if top-line momentum is slowing. The companyโs focus on profitability over top-line expansion appears to be a deliberate strategic pivot, but it raises questions about long-term market share dynamics.

Looking ahead, Commerce.com expects continued EPS growth driven by operational leverage and the rollout of new value-added features. The company anticipates further margin improvements as it scales its platform and optimizes its cost structure. However, management acknowledged potential headwinds from macroeconomic uncertainties, competitive pressures, and changing consumer spending patterns. Guidance for future quarters was not explicitly provided, but the company remains committed to its profitability-first strategy. Strategic priorities include deepening partnerships with key enterprise clients and exploring adjacent markets. Risk factors such as market volatility and potential regulatory changes may impact future performance. The company may also evaluate share repurchase programs to support shareholder value, though no specific plans were announced.

The market reaction to the earnings release was somewhat puzzling given the strong earnings surprise. The stock declined 2.03%, likely reflecting disappointment over the absence of revenue figures and the lack of explicit forward guidance. Analyst views are expected to be mixed; some may applaud the profit beat and cost discipline, while others flag the incomplete revenue picture as a red flag. The cautious market response suggests that near-term upside may be limited until the company provides greater transparency on top-line trends. Investors should watch for any future updates on revenue drivers, customer acquisition metrics, and the impact of ongoing investments. The stockโs performance may also hinge on broader market sentiment and sector trends in the e-commerce space.
